Specialist Support Worker


Job description

Are you passionate about making a real difference in the lives of vulnerable young people. Join our dynamic and innovative HFFY service, supporting a small group of Looked After Children aged 16 to 21 to live safely, independently, and with stability in the community.

Responsibilities

  • Ensure the needs of young people are effectively met by promoting independence through support, development, and progression.
  • Establish supportive relationships with young people and handle problematic and difficult situations in an appropriate and sensitive manner, providing support and advice when needed.
  • Monitor young people’s physical/mental health and liaise with specialist services as appropriate.
  • Motivate young people to identify and work towards individual goals consistent with sustaining their independence and wellbeing.
  • Hold regular meetings with young people primarily in the community; discussing their needs and working with them to identify options.
